Responsibilities

  • Provide friendly and professional customer service to all guests
  • Prepare and serve al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ages
  • Operate VLT terminals and handle cash transactions accurately
  • Monitor VLT area and assist guests as needed
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the bar and VLT area
  • Follow all liquor service and responsible service guidelines
  • Support overall lounge operations and assist team members when needed
  • Prepare and serve a variety of drinks, quickly and efficiently, according to guest requests
  • All other duties as assigned.
